A reservoir in the form of a rectangular parallelopiped is 20 m long. If 18 kl of water is removed from the reservoir, the water level goes down by 15 cm. Find the width of the reservoir.
Let the width of the reservoir = x m
Volume of water flowing from the reservoir = l × b × h
= 20 × x × 0.15
= 3x m3
Volume of the water removed = 18 m3 (1m3 = 1000 litre)
Hence 3x = 18 ⇒ x = 6m
∴ Width of the reservoir = 6m
